Fatehpur Dumra in context

With 446 people at the 2011 Census, Fatehpur Dumra was the 949th most populous of its district's 1055 villages, below the district average of 2,294.

Literacy stood at 47.23%, 15.2 points below the district's rural average of 62.44%.

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 776, 147 below the rural national 923.
